How much do junior project eng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 14, 2026, the average yearly pay for junior project engineer in Texas is $66,892.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45,200.00 and $74,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Can you become a junior project engineer with no experience?

Junior project engineer roles typically require some related education or internship experience, but entry-level candidates with strong technical skills, a relevant degree, and willingness to learn can sometimes qualify. Employers often provide on-the-job training to develop necessary skills such as project management software and technical knowledge. Having certifications like OSHA or PMP can also improve chances for those with limited experience.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a junior project engineer?

To thrive as a Junior Project Engineer, you need a solid understanding of engineering principles, project management basics, and a relevant bachelor's degree in engineering. Familiarity with project management software (like MS Project or Primavera), CAD tools, and sometimes certifications like EIT (Engineer in Training) are typically required. Strong communication, problem-solving, and teamwork skills help you effectively coordinate with diverse project stakeholders. These skills and qualifications are crucial for delivering successful projects on time and within budget while supporting senior engineers and learning on the job.

What is the difference between Junior Project Engineer vs Project Coordinator?

AspectJunior Project EngineerProject Coordinator
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Engineering or related field, some certificationsBachelor's degree, often in business or related field
Work EnvironmentEngineering teams, construction sites, project planningAdministrative offices, project management teams
Employer & Industry UsageConstruction, engineering, manufacturingConstruction, IT, event planning

Junior Project Engineers focus on technical and engineering tasks within projects, often working closely with engineers and technical teams. Project Coordinators handle administrative and logistical aspects, supporting project managers. Both roles are essential but differ in technical involvement and responsibilities.

What does a junior project engineer do?

A Junior Project Engineer assists in planning, coordinating, and executing engineering projects under the supervision of senior engineers. Their responsibilities typically include preparing project documentation, conducting research, supporting design and implementation tasks, and communicating with team members and stakeholders. They often help monitor project progress, ensure compliance with safety and quality standards, and address technical issues as they arise. This role is ideal for recent engineering graduates looking to gain practical experience and develop their project management skills.

Overview

Gemma Power Systems is seeking a Jr. Project Accountant to join our team on one of our project sites in Texas. The Jr. Project Accountant is a vital part of the Gemma team, dedicated to being a liaison between the project site and home office accounting. Gemma is looking for a self-motivated individual who is extremely organized, comfortable with technology, and has strong time management skills. This position will be based in either Reeves County or Ward County, TX, depending on which project you are assigned to, and will require you to relocate to the area of your assigned project. You may also be required to relocate to the area of any future projects that you may be assigned to.


Position Summary

This Jr. Project Accountant is responsible for providing support to the Project Accountant in performing daily accounting & payroll functions for the project jobsite. Responsibilities include assisting with data entry, invoice & purchase order processing, document tracking, and coordination with the home office on project-related accounting & procurement activities. The Jr. Project Accountant helps ensure accurate and timely financial reporting and supports the overall efficiency of project accounting operations.


Duties and Responsibilities

  • Assist with processing & reconciling on weekly payroll using ADP for all craft/hourly personnel.
  • Prepare journal entries for craft payroll and prepare supporting information.
  • Help coordinate other payroll procedures or pay runs as needed.
  • Provide assistance with reconciling & managing jobsite bank accounts.
  • Audit, verify approval, and submit expense reports for jobsite employees.
  • Create purchase/change orders and submit to vendors through DocuSign.
  • Enter purchase orders, change orders, and invoices into accounting software (Sage 300 and TimberScan).
  • Support the preparation of monthly invoices to ensure accurate & timely billing.
  • Perform three-way match for AP invoices associated with jobsite.
  • Maintain documentation for home office, including rental log, purchase order log, and certificates of insurance.
